Key Points
- •AI agents are autonomous systems that can perceive their environment, make decisions, and take actions to achieve specific goals
- •Agents work best for repetitive, rule-based tasks that follow predictable patterns and workflows
- •Identify automation candidates by looking for tasks that are time-consuming, error-prone, or require consistent execution
- •AI agents can integrate with multiple tools and systems to perform complex multi-step workflows automatically
- •Not all tasks are suitable for automation—consider whether a task has clear inputs, outputs, and decision logic
- •Agents improve efficiency by reducing manual intervention and human error in routine business processes
- •Common use cases include data processing, customer service, scheduling, and information retrieval
- •Understanding agent limitations helps set realistic expectations about what automation can and cannot accomplish
